Your Role
The Complex Automation & Processing team is responsible for the analytical review and processing of complex provider demographic data received from internal and external sources. The Associate Business Analyst will report to the supervisor. In this role, you will collaborate with colleagues and leverage analytical skills in support of complex processing and the demographic automation process.
Your Work
In this role, you will:
- Provide basic analytical support through the analysis and interpretation of data in support of cross-functional business operations
- Work cross-functionally in analyzing, designing, and developing business solutions
- Identify opportunities for improvement in operational performance and notify management of issues and problems requiring immediate attention
- Assist in defining business requirements and provide analysis to increase operational efficiency
- Assist in the development of annual operating plans, capital budgets and forecasts, and build business cases for new business initiatives (cost/benefit analysis)
- Leverage automation tools and resources to analyze process demographic data
- Identify opportunities for process design changes in automation tools and participate in UAT testing for enhancements
- Provide support for data clean-up projects
- Assist in complex provider demographic processing as needed
- Manage inventory to ensure the department and individual goals are met
- Utilize training and feedback as a tool for upskilling in job area
Your Knowledge and Experience
- Requires a bachelor’s degree or equivalent experience
- 0-2 years of prior relevant experience
- Requires analytical and problem-solving skills
- Requires strong communication skills
- Requires practical experience with excel
- Requires experience with provider demographic data
- Experience in PIMS is not mandatory but is beneficial
